O R D E R

The petitioner has filed the writ petition for issuance of a Writ of Mandamus, directing the 1st respondent herein not to do any act except under due process of law in respect of the petitioner's peaceful possession and enjoyment of his lands in S.F.No.741, T.S.No.451/1, 2 and S.F.No.742, T.S.No.452/4, with an extent of 70 1⁄2 cents situated in Nallur Village within Tiruppur Municipal Town and Taluk, Coimbatore District and to further direct the 3rd respondent herein to give protection to the petitioner's life and property.

2. The petitioner has not produced any material to show that the 1st respondent has attempted to disturb the peaceful possession and enjoyment of the lands and tried to put a road across the petitioner's land.

3. In the light of failure on the part of the petitioner to produce necessary details, no direction could be issued by this Court.

4. Accordingly, the writ petition stands dismissed as not maintainable. No costs. Consequently, connected miscellaneous petition is closed.
